How Powerlifting Impacts Functional Strength

Powerlifting, a sport focused on maximizing strength in three key lifts—squat, bench press, and deadlift—can significantly influence functional strength, which is the ability to perform everyday movements and tasks efficiently.

1. Core Stability

The heavy lifts in powerlifting engage multiple muscle groups, particularly the core. Developing a strong core enhances stability and control, which is essential for functional movements like lifting heavy objects or maintaining balance.

2. Muscle Hypertrophy

Powerlifting promotes muscle hypertrophy through progressive overload. Increased muscle mass contributes to functional strength by offering greater force production, making day-to-day activities easier, such as climbing stairs or carrying groceries.

3. Movement Pattern Specificity

The specific movement patterns trained in powerlifting can translate into improved performance in various physical activities. The squat and deadlift, for instance, mimic the mechanics of picking items off the ground or standing up from a seated position.

4. Joint and Ligament Strength

Heavy lifting under controlled conditions strengthens joints and ligaments, reducing the risk of injury during everyday activities. This is crucial for maintaining long-term functional strength as one ages.

5. Confidence and Mental Resilience

Successfully lifting heavy weights can boost confidence and mental toughness. This psychological aspect can encourage individuals to tackle more physical tasks in their daily lives, further enhancing functional strength.
